Quick answer
Anti-bedsore air mattresses are essential for patients confined to bed for extended periods — post-surgery recovery, stroke patients, elderly with reduced mobility, paraplegic patients, and palliative care at home. The category divides clearly: bubble pads (Easycare, Surgipro) are entry-level — small bubble cells inflate and deflate alternately to redistribute pressure; tubular cell mattresses (Apex, MedAids, Hicks) are more advanced — large tubular cells provide deeper pressure redistribution and better suit longer-term bedridden care; low-air-loss mattresses (medical-grade, rare under ₹15,000) circulate continuous airflow to prevent moisture buildup. The deciding factor is the alternating pump motor — cheap silent-pump units cycle every 10 minutes, which is too slow for serious pressure-injury prevention; quality units cycle every 5–6 minutes. The non-trivial mistake is buying a bubble pad for a long-term bedridden patient — bubble pads suit 4–6 hour patient confinement (post-surgery day patients), not weeks-long care.

Editor's read
For long-term home care, tubular cell mattresses (Apex, Hicks, MedAids) are markedly better than bubble pads — pressure redistribution depth matters. Always pair with regular position changes (every 2 hours) and skin checks. An air mattress alone doesn't replace caregiver vigilance — pressure injuries develop fast and silently.

What to Look For
- 1.Bubble pad vs tubular cell: Bubble pads are entry-level — small cells, lower pressure redistribution, suit short-term confinement (1–2 weeks post-surgery). Tubular cell mattresses are clinical-grade — large cells, deeper pressure redistribution, suit long-term bedridden care.
- 2.Pump cycle time: 5–6 minute cycles are clinically effective. 10+ minute cycles (cheap units) are too slow to prevent pressure injuries. Look for 'fast-cycle' or specified cycle time in specs.
- 3.Patient weight capacity: Most mattresses are rated for 100–150 kg. For heavier patients, verify the rated capacity — exceeding it reduces pressure redistribution effectiveness.
- 4.Pump noise: 30–40 dB is acceptable for night use. Anything above 50 dB disrupts patient sleep. Quality pumps from Apex and Hicks run at 30–35 dB; cheap pumps at 50+ dB.
- 5.CPR-quick release: Critical-care mattresses include a CPR-release valve that deflates the mattress in seconds during emergencies. Standard for clinical-grade units; missing on cheap bubble pads.
- 6.Mattress cover material: Vinyl is the standard — waterproof and easily wiped clean. Some premium mattresses use breathable PU coatings — more comfortable but more expensive.
